  4. The University of Western Australia is responsible for nearly 70% of university research in Western Australia, which attracts many researchers from different countries. The research fields cover plant and food science, ecology, evolution and environmental theory, energy and minerals, indigenous knowledge, medical and Health, mental and nervous system, etc.
